About This Bridge
INTERSTATE 10 is a 64-year-old bridge located 08-Sbd-010-26.27-Lmln in San Bernardino County, California. The bridge carries INTERSTATE 10 over Tippecanoe Avenue with 9 traffic lanes, handling approximately 131K vehicles per day. Built in 1962 and reconstructed in 2016, the structure spans 49.4 meters.
The bridge received a Condition Grade of B (71/100) based on Federal Highway Administration inspection data. Its deck is rated 7/9 (good), superstructure 7/9 (good), and substructure 7/9 (good).
This bridge is owned and maintained by State Highway Agency.
